Lipid peroxidation is one of the main manifestations of oxidative damage and has been found to play an important role in the toxicity and carcinogenesis of many carcinogens. This study was carried out to determine the effects of vitamin C on lipid contents and fatty acid compositions of serum and liver in male rats treated with radiation or aflatoxin B₁ (AFB₁). Six week-old male Sprague-Dawley rats were randomly divided into 7 groups; control group, radiation exposed group, AFB₁ treated group, X-ray and AFB₁ co-treated group.
